在当今的软件开发领域,技术栈的选择至关重要,对于那些寻求高效、可扩展和跨平台解决方案的开发人员来说,PHP、Java 和 C++ 是三种非常流行的编程语言,本文将探讨这三种语言在开发过程中的优势和应用场景,以及它们之间的异同。
我们来了解一下 PHP,PHP是一种开源的服务器端脚本语言,主要用于Web开发,它的语法简洁易懂,学习曲线较为平缓,PHP可以与HTML结合使用,生成动态网页内容,也可以嵌入到JavaScript代码中,PHP还支持多种数据库系统,如MySQL、PostgreSQL等,方便开发者进行数据存储和检索,由于其在Web开发领域的广泛应用,PHP社区拥有丰富的资源和插件库,使得开发者能够快速实现各种功能。
接下来是 Java,Java是一种面向对象的编程语言,具有跨平台、安全可靠等特点,Java的应用领域非常广泛,包括Web应用、移动应用(如Android)、企业级应用等,Java的优点在于其强大的生态系统,包括大量的开源库和框架,如Spring、Hibernate等,可以帮助开发者快速构建高性能、可维护的应用程序,Java还具有良好的安全性和稳定性,使得它在金融、医疗等关键行业得到广泛应用。
C++,C++是一种通用的编程语言,以其高性能和灵活性而闻名,C++支持底层硬件操作,可以编写高效的系统软件和游戏引擎,C++的优点在于其对内存的管理能力,可以有效地避免内存泄漏和其他内存相关的问题,C++的学习曲线相对较陡峭,需要开发者具备较强的编程基础和调试能力,尽管如此,C++仍然是许多高性能应用和游戏的首选编程语言。
PHP、Java 和 C++ 都是非常优秀的编程语言,各自具有独特的优势和特点,在实际开发过程中,根据项目需求和个人喜好选择合适的编程语言是非常重要的,对于那些希望在Web开发、移动应用或系统软件等领域发挥所长的开发人员来说,掌握这三种编程语言无疑是一项宝贵的技能。
还没有评论,来说两句吧...